The Ascent of XRP: An Analysis of Coinbase’s Q2 2025 Revenue Shift

Introduction: A Seismic Shift in the Crypto Landscape

The cryptocurrency market, known for its rapid fluctuations and groundbreaking innovations, has once again demonstrated its unpredictable nature in Q2 2025. Coinbase, a leading cryptocurrency exchange, reported a surprising shift in its revenue composition, with XRP, the digital asset linked to Ripple, surpassing Ethereum in consumer transaction revenue. While Bitcoin continues to dominate with a 34% share, XRP’s rise to 13%—surpassing Ethereum’s 12%—is not just a statistical blip but a potential indicator of a broader realignment within the crypto ecosystem. Understanding the Numbers: A Deep Dive into Coinbase’s Revenue Streams

To fully grasp the significance of XRP’s ascent, it’s essential to examine Coinbase’s revenue structure. Transaction revenue, the focus of this analysis, primarily stems from trading fees generated when users buy or sell cryptocurrencies on the platform. This metric serves as a direct indicator of user engagement and trading activity surrounding specific assets.

Coinbase’s Q2 2025 figures reveal a nuanced picture. While overall retail trading volumes experienced a decline, XRP defied the trend, showcasing remarkable resilience and even growth. This divergence suggests a dedicated and active community rallying behind XRP, possibly fueled by a confluence of factors. Notably, during certain periods within the quarter, XRP’s revenue share peaked at an impressive 18%, hinting at moments of intense trading activity.

Furthermore, examining the first half of 2025 paints an even clearer picture of XRP’s upward trajectory. Over these six months, XRP contributed 16% to Coinbase’s total transactional revenue, dwarfing Ethereum’s 11%. This sustained performance underscores that XRP’s Q2 success wasn’t merely a fleeting phenomenon but rather a continuation of an established trend.

The Driving Forces: Decoding XRP’s Resurgence

Several factors likely contributed to XRP’s impressive performance on Coinbase:

Legal Clarity and Ripple’s Regulatory Progress

Ripple’s ongoing legal battle with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has been a major overhang on XRP’s price and adoption. Positive developments in the case, or even the perception of such, tend to trigger bursts of activity and price appreciation. Any signals suggesting a favorable outcome for Ripple could alleviate uncertainty and attract both retail and institutional investors back to XRP.

Speculation Surrounding Spot XRP ETFs

The introduction of Bitcoin ETFs has had a transformative impact on the cryptocurrency market, opening the doors to institutional capital and wider adoption. The possibility of a spot XRP ETF has been a recurring topic of speculation, fueling excitement and potentially driving up demand for XRP in anticipation of such a product launch.

XRP’s Unique Value Proposition: Focus on Cross-Border Payments

XRP is designed to facilitate faster and cheaper cross-border payments, a real-world use case that continues to resonate with businesses and individuals alike. While the broader cryptocurrency market often focuses on speculative trading, XRP’s inherent utility provides a fundamental value proposition that can attract users seeking practical solutions.

Ethereum’s Perspective: Why the Second Place Finish?

While XRP’s success is noteworthy, it’s equally important to understand why Ethereum might have lagged behind in terms of Coinbase’s consumer transaction revenue during Q2 2025. Several factors could have contributed:

Market Saturation and Maturity

Ethereum, as the second-largest cryptocurrency, has already achieved significant market penetration. Its adoption is widespread, and its price movements might be less volatile compared to XRP, potentially leading to lower trading volumes among retail investors seeking quick profits.

Focus on Institutional Adoption and DeFi

Ethereum’s strengths lie in its robust ecosystem of decentralized applications (dApps) and its appeal to institutional investors. While retail trading remains important, Ethereum’s long-term growth strategy focuses on attracting institutional capital and expanding its presence in the decentralized finance (DeFi) space. This strategic focus might lead to less emphasis on retail trading volumes compared to XRP.

ETF Impact Diversion

While the potential for ETH ETFs exists, the current market focus had been on the already approved and heavily traded BTC ETFs. This may have diverted some attention and trading volume away from ETH, indirectly benefiting assets like XRP which were also speculated to potentially have an ETF product in the future.

Gas Fees and Network Congestion

Ethereum’s high gas fees and network congestion have been persistent challenges. These issues can deter smaller traders and reduce overall trading activity, particularly during periods of high demand.
